NAOMI LUCY KORGAARD January 30, 1939 - May 16, 2018 After a courageous battle with cancer, it is with great sadness that we announce the passing of our beloved Mom, Naomi Lucy Korgaard, on May 16, 2018, in Edmonton, Alberta. Naomi will be sadly missed and lovingly remembered by her three children: daughter Wendy (Kevin), her two sons, Glenn and Roger (Nancy); as well as her five grandchildren: Blair (Chantel), Scott (Adrienne), Danielle, Emily and Calum; and her three great-grandchildren: Zoey, Ryker and Sarah. Naomi was predeceased by her mother Lucy, her father Leo and her brother Garth. Naomi was a fiercely independent woman who seldom considered any task beyond her capabilities. She lived alone at her home at Antler Lake, Alberta since July of 1982 and thoroughly enjoyed the freedom, peace, tranquility and solitude that country life afforded her. She was a gifted seamstress, an avid gardener and had a natural flair for interior decorating. She was an artist at heart, creating many lovely oil paintings throughout her lifetime. The creative touch of her paintbrush could be seen on all sorts of surfaces inside and outside her home. Naomi was deeply spiritual and spent many years studying this subject that was so dear to her heart. In her later years, her passion was doing cross-stitch and petit point needlework, completing numerous masterpieces that she proudly displayed throughout her home. At her request, there will be no funeral service. Naomi's family would like to extend heartfelt thanks for the wonderful care and attention she was given by her doctors; the staff and nurses on Unit 42 at the Grey Nuns Hospital; and all of her caregivers at the Palliative Care Unit at Capital Care Norwood in Edmonton. Your constant care eased our hearts and was greatly appreciated. In lieu of flowers, please consider making a donation to the Canadian Cancer Society. GLENWOOD FUNERAL HOME Phone: (780) 467-3337
